Including the Environmental Activists … then the political tangle of one set of Politicians not wanting to give up land at Aarey terminal & ……..to top it all the heavy monsoon fury & flooding of the underground tracks ……. well well …. all that is history ….. after almost a decade Mumbai now has a Swanky … beautiful Underground Metro – The Aqua Line 3 connecting Cuffe Parade in Colaba in deep South Mumbai to Aarey colony up North ….. all but one of the 27 stations are underground …… it’s a Dream come True as I boarded at Cuffe Parade & alighted at Worli …. all in just 23 minutes & only Rs 50 for the ticket ….. & …..honestly this Aqua line 3 infra is better than any I have experienced lately in London , New York , Frankfurt or Tokyo …… it’s brand new & sparkling clean & fully Air-conditioned & very well staffed …..…..

Total cost of 37,276 crores has been worth the investment …. for it reduces 35% of vehicle population on roads & transports 1.3 million Mumbaikars in comfort … it surely is the way forward for Bangalore & other cities to emulate ….. the Mumbai way …. the futuristic way …. the SEEGOS way.
